In case of `C_4` - plants , which enzyme fixes the `CO_2` released during decarboxylation of malate

A

RuBisCO

B

MDH

C

PEPase

D

None of these

Text Solution

AI Generated Solution

The correct Answer is:
To answer the question regarding which enzyme fixes the CO₂ released during the decarboxylation of malate in C₄ plants, we can follow these steps: ### Step-by-Step Solution: 1. **Understanding C₄ Photosynthesis**: - C₄ plants have a specialized mechanism for photosynthesis that allows them to efficiently fix CO₂, especially in conditions of high light intensity and temperature. 2. **Formation of Oxaloacetic Acid**: - In the mesophyll cells of C₄ plants, CO₂ is initially fixed to phosphoenolpyruvate (PEP) by the enzyme PEP carboxylase (often abbreviated as PEPcase). This reaction produces oxaloacetic acid (OAA), which is a four-carbon compound. 3. **Conversion to Malate**: - The oxaloacetic acid is then converted into malate (another four-carbon compound) through a series of reactions, which involves the reduction of OAA using NADPH. 4. **Transport to Bundle Sheath Cells**: - The malate is transported from the mesophyll cells to the bundle sheath cells where it undergoes decarboxylation. 5. **Decarboxylation of Malate**: - In the bundle sheath cells, malate is decarboxylated to release CO₂ and pyruvate. This reaction is catalyzed by the enzyme malic enzyme. 6. **Fixation of CO₂**: - The CO₂ released during the decarboxylation of malate is then fixed into the Calvin cycle (C₃ cycle) by the enzyme ribulose bisphosphate carboxylase/oxygenase (commonly known as Rubisco). 7. **Conclusion**: - Therefore, the enzyme that fixes the CO₂ released during the decarboxylation of malate in C₄ plants is **Rubisco**. ### Final Answer: The enzyme that fixes the CO₂ released during the decarboxylation of malate in C₄ plants is **Rubisco**. ---
